About the role
We have an exciting opportunity to join our Planning & Scheduling South leadership team as a Technical Planner.
This Technical Planner role supports both our Planning & Scheduling team and our Water Networks teams. You will ensure pre-site validation of field activities to enable efficient planning & scheduling. This includes supporting the team to optimise planning, assess and to mitigate risks associated with the execution of field activities. The role also includes support to in-day jeopardy management of field work execution.
Our Technical Planner role supports job promoters with coaching in the field to ensure right first-time job promotion is achieved and is a key in supporting continuous improvement within Planning & Scheduling and across all areas of our water network operations and maintenance processes.
Customer Service is of paramount importance and as a Technical Planner you will ensure we deliver on all promises for our customers safely and efficiently.
Performance reporting for the planning team, contract partners and field colleagues are also key responsibilities in this role to support these teams in achieving industry leading results.

NWG (Northumbrian Water Group) provides water and sewerage services to 2.7 million people in the North East of England as Northumbrian Water, and water services to 1.5 million people in the South East of England as Essex & Suffolk Water.
We are proud to serve our customers and we're committed to delivering great service, putting our customers at the heart of everything we do.
